preload: init at 0.6.4
[NixPkgs.git] / pkgs / by-name / ro / robotfindskitten / package.nix
bloba955d337753ef4a9786fc47c20e586d8bee683d5
1 { lib
2 , stdenv
3 , fetchFromGitHub
4 , autoreconfHook
5 , ncurses
6 , pkg-config
7 , texinfo
8 }:
10 stdenv.mkDerivation (finalAttrs: {
11   pname = "robotfindskitten";
12   version = "2.8284271.702";
14   src = fetchFromGitHub {
15     owner = "robotfindskitten";
16     repo = "robotfindskitten";
17     rev = finalAttrs.version;
18     hash = "sha256-z6//Yfp3BtJAtUdY05m1eKVrTdH19MvK7LZOwX5S1CM=";
19   };
21   outputs = [ "out" "man" "info" ];
23   nativeBuildInputs = [
24     autoreconfHook
25     pkg-config
26     texinfo
27   ];
29   buildInputs = [
30     ncurses
31   ];
33   makeFlags = [
34     "execgamesdir=$(out)/bin"
35   ];
37   postInstall = ''
38     install -Dm644 nki/vanilla.nki -t $out/share/games/robotfindskitten/
39   '';
41   meta = {
42     description = "Yet another zen simulation; A simple find-the-kitten game";
43     homepage = "http://robotfindskitten.org/";
44     license = lib.licenses.gpl2Plus;
45     mainProgram = "robotfindskitten";
46     maintainers = [ lib.maintainers.AndersonTorres ];
47     platforms = lib.platforms.unix;
48   };